Breed Health 
 We are seeing some genetic problems that have plagued the dog world for many years. It would be wonderful to say that this breed is problem free. But, reality says that this is not the case. ALL breeds have problems. It is the degree to which they are seen…. how reliable breeders are with testing…. and then reporting the results that become the real issues at hand. Testing has just begun, therefore numbers are not available. With any breed , it will be up to the breeders themselves to determine what is important to them to test for in the lines they are building.

The American Hairless Terrier is a CHIC breed with OFA

Here is a list of a few things that have been reported, even if only once:


  • Malocclusions
  • Demodect Mange – Juvenile
  • Demodect Mange – Generalized
  • Legg-Calve Perthes
  • Patellar Luxation
  • Liver Shunt
  • Deafness
  • Epilepsy
  • Hip Dysplasia
  • Diabetes
  • Cleft Palate
  • Immune mediated hemolytic anemia
  • Seizures – no known source
  • Blue Dog disease
  • Club Foot
  • Frontal leg diameter abnormality
  • Allergies
  • Von Willebrand’s disease
  • Heart murmur
  • Cushings Disease
  • Thyroid problems
  • Hemophelia A
  • Primary Lens Luxation Ca
  • Microvascular Dysplasia
